What Damages Can Be Recovered For Breach Of Contract
To recover consequential damages a party must show that damages of the type sought were within the contemplation of the parties at the time of contracting that the damages were actually caused by the breach and that the amount of the damages can be shown with reasonable certainty. However in principle negotiating damages can be awarded for breach of contract where the loss suffered by the claimant is appropriately measured by reference to the economic value of the right which has been breached.

When negotiating damages will be recoverable is not entirely clear from the case law but the Supreme Court has recently held that this approach will not usually be appropriate for breach of contract claims where damages are usually based on actual loss. Owners of buildings are entitled to rectification costs as opposed to merely the diminution in value of the building subject to a test of necessity and reasonableness. If no loss is caused by the breach of contract only nominal damages can be recovered So damages will only be awarded if the breach actually causes a loss Nominal damages a small amount of damages. Expectation damages are intended to put the wronged party in the position it would have been in if the contract had been fulfilled as intended.
